Bihar and India's Infrastructure Developments in 2025

Bihar and India's Infrastructure Developments in 2025
Big-ticket projects mark 2025 as transformational year for Bihar · thestatesman.com

In 2025, Bihar and other parts of India saw a lot of big new projects to make the country better.

In Bihar, new parts of airports in Patna and Purnea were opened, and a new airport is being built in Bihta.

There are also new big roads and bridges, like the Kachchi Dargah-Bidupur Bridge over the Ganga River and the Aunta–Simaria Bridge.

A new power plant is being built to make more electricity.

The Patna Medical College and Hospital is getting bigger to help more people.

The Patna Metro train also started running a small part of its route.

In other parts of India, 60 railway stations in the northeast are being redeveloped.

New railway tracks and bridges are being built, like the Bairabi-Sairang line that connects Aizawl to the rail network for the first time.

There are also big projects like the Udhampur-Srinagar-Baramula Rail Link (USBRL) and the New Pamban Railway Bridge.

These projects will help people travel easier, get better healthcare, and make the economy stronger.

Key facts

Airport Developments
New terminal at Patna Airport, new airport at Bihta, new terminal at Purnea Airport
Road Projects
Six-lane Kachchi Dargah-Bidupur Bridge, Aunta–Simaria Bridge, Bakhtiyarpur–Mokama road
Power Project
660-MW Buxar Thermal Power Plant
Healthcare
Expansion of Patna Medical College and Hospital to 5,000 beds
Metro Project
Patna Metro Phase One operational over 3.6 km
Investment
Over Rs 5,000 crore for Kachchi Dargah-Bidupur Bridge, Rs 1,770 crore for Aunta–Simaria Bridge, Rs 1,900 crore for Bakhtiyarpur–Mokama road
Economic Impact
Expected boost in tourism, trade, and investment opportunities
Railway Stations Redeveloped
60 stations in the northeastern region under the Amrit Bharat Station Scheme
Railway Tracks Laid
More than 1,679 km of railway tracks laid in the northeast since 2014
Route Kilometres Electrified
Over 2,500 route kilometres electrified in the northeast
Road Overbridges and Underbridges
More than 470 constructed in the northeast
New Railway Lines
Bairabi-Sairang new line fully commissioned, connecting Aizawl to the rail network
Major Railway Projects
Sivok-Rangpo, Dimapur-Kohima, Jiribam-Imphal projects progressing steadily
Udhampur-Srinagar-Baramula Rail Link (USBRL)
272-km line passing through the Himalayan region, costing approx. Rs 44,000 crore
Chenab Rail Bridge
World’s highest railway arch bridge, 359 metres above the river
Anji Rail Bridge
India’s first cable-stayed railway bridge over the Anji River
USBRL Features
36 tunnels (119 km), 943 bridges, all-weather rail connectivity to the Kashmir Valley
New Pamban Railway Bridge
India’s first vertical-lift sea bridge, costing about Rs 550 crore, 2.08 km long
High-Speed Rail
Mumbai-Ahmedabad High-Speed Rail Project, 331 km of viaduct work completed out of 508 km
